Ortolá was born in 1955, founded by José Ortolá Montaner, a musician by profession. Resulting from the need to protect his instruments on numerous trips and presentations he made, he set up a small workshop dedicated to the manufacture of instrument bags along with his wife.
The Ortolá factory is located in La Pobla del Duc, Valencia, Spain. It is equipped with advanced machinery and state-of-the-art technology. Much of the production is destined for export. The production process relies on high quality raw material, which allows Ortolá to guarantee a good share of the market.
